  35. Anonymous users2024-01-09

    Drinking coffee during pregnancy has a certain effect on the fetus. Coffee contains caffeine, which can be absorbed in the mother's body and enter the fetus through the placenta, affecting the growth and development of the fetus, and can also act on the uterus, causing uterine contractions, resulting in fetal miscarriage and premature birth, so try not to drink coffee during pregnancy.
